好几年没发邮件了,有什么变化吗?我们仍然在表格上打字,并且样式是内联的?我试图在caniuse.email上查找电子邮件客户端使用统计信息来检查 CSS 属性支持,但它们都没有电子邮件客户端版本:litmus.com、emailmonday.com。
可以在不支持新版本 HTML 和 CSS 的电子邮件客户端和浏览器中打开邮件。表格布局是保证字母不会“传播”,在所有平台上都能正常显示。–来源
情况与 CSS 网格布局相同 - 似乎我们将新技术推迟到最后一刻,以支持几乎死掉的浏览器或旧的电子邮件客户端,就像我们的例子一样。分享你的统计数据,如果你有的话,也许只有我觉得撰写电子邮件的目标受众已经坐在 Gmail 和 Mail App 上很长时间了,你可以使用 HTML5 标签、媒体查询和其他好东西漫游。
如果我们不开始讨论并假设一切仍然很糟糕,并且字母的布局是具有内联样式的表格,那么目前正在使用哪些工具?是否正在使用框架,例如Zurb Foundation for Emails 2 - 这是我发现的唯一支持预处理器的东西。还是您自己的带有inline-css和 go 的程序集?
请不要发送给 Google - 所有文章要么已经过时,要么年复一年地重新表述相同的想法,没有任何权威意见。
在过去的几年里,主要的电子邮件客户端根本没有改变。一切都是一样的,所有相同的Outlook和其他古老的和古老的都存在。这意味着我们还会在必要时内联样式,以便字母随处打开。
谷歌网站做的一切都是正确的,总的来说,没有任何改变。是的,现在可以在内部指定一些 CSS
<style>,例如自 2016 年以来的 Gmail,以及其他一些客户端,但对于其他所有人,一切都与以前相同。所以我们像往常一样弥补。在相对较新的程序中,可以注意到将样式直接内联到标签中的程序(例如one、two)。然而,几年前他们也是。
在全球范围内,一切仍然令人难过,字母的布局是带有内联样式的表格。但在 2018 年,我建议你使用MJML电子邮件框架。
优点:
缺点:
是的,没错,什么都没有改变。我们也在表格中做所有事情。但直到现在才有用于快速布局信件的服务构造器 - 在电子邮件邮寄服务本身和第三方资源上,例如,这个 - https://stripo.email/ru/。
具有对代码的开放访问权限,以及下载和编辑 html 文档的能力。
老实说,我不知道框架。没有遇见。目前,实际的邮件服务是 gmail 和 yandex。如果您使用构造函数,然后将一切变为现实,那么它非常具有适应性并且可以工作。